Drunk driving remains one of the leading causes of serious crashes in Arizona. In 2023 alone, there were 5,761 alcohol-related accidents statewide, resulting in hundreds of fatalities and thousands of injuries. Glendale’s busy roads, including Loop 101, Glendale Avenue, and Grand Avenue, have heavy traffic day and night, creating a dangerous mix when impaired drivers get behind the wheel.
These crashes often occur at higher speeds and in unpredictable ways, leaving victims with devastating injuries. Understanding the risks on Glendale’s roadways highlights the importance of holding negligent drivers accountable and pursuing justice after a preventable DUI-related accident.
Establishing liability is a critical step in any Glendale drunk driving accident claim. Evidence often includes police reports, field sobriety test results, blood alcohol concentration readings, and witness statements. In some cases, video footage from traffic cameras or nearby businesses can strengthen the proof of impairment.
Arizona law also allows for civil claims even while a criminal DUI case is pending, meaning victims do not need to wait for the outcome of the criminal trial to take action.
Additionally, under ARS 12-511, the statute of limitations is tolled during the criminal proceedings, and victims have an extra year from the case’s final disposition to file a civil claim. In Maricopa County courts, timely filing and thorough documentation are essential for ensuring the responsible driver is held financially accountable.
The impact of a drunk driving accident in Glendale can result in physical and emotional suffering that lasts a lifetime. Many victims need long rehabilitation, surgeries, or therapies to recover mobility or independence. Traumatic brain injuries, spinal cord injuries, and internal organ damage can cause long-term complications that affect work and family activities.
Local hospitals, such as Banner Thunderbird Medical Center and Abrazo Arrowhead Campus, often treat these types of injuries. Victims could face years of recovery, job loss, financial difficulty, and emotional trauma, which is why it is important to make sure victims receive full compensation.
Those who have suffered in a Glendale drunk driving accident are entitled to many different types of compensation under Arizona law. For example, monetary recovery can encompass both economic and non-economic damages, including lost income and pain and suffering.
In DUI cases, the court may also assess punitive damages against the reckless driver to help deter them and others from committing the same behavior in the future. Victims may also be compensated for their future needs, such as diminished earning capacity or a permanent disability.
By fully recovering all their financial losses, an accident victim can use these funds to get back on their feet and move forward with their lives.

Arizona dram shop laws can make a bar, restaurant, or even a social host responsible if they overserved a patron who later was in a crash. If a bar or other establishment continued to serve alcohol to an obviously intoxicated person, they may be found partially liable. Social hosts can also be liable for overserving alcohol to a guest. This may help provide additional sources of compensation beyond the impaired driver’s own insurance.
As a passenger involved in a DUI crash, you still have legal rights to pursue compensation. Even if the driver was a family member or friend, passengers are allowed to file injury claims under Arizona law. Damages from a passenger claim can cover medical bills, lost income, and pain and suffering the passenger endured due to the driver’s negligence. Civil passenger claims help injured passengers obtain financial restitution after a crash.
Insurance companies are in the business of reducing payouts as much as possible, even in DUI accidents where liability is obvious. An insurer may challenge the severity of your damages or rush you into a lowball settlement for a quick close.
In Glendale, record your injuries carefully, keep receipts of expenses, and understand your rights before accepting a provider’s offer. Your long-term financial recovery from this incident can be protected through this approach.
